Our verdict is Likely benign. Variant got -3 ACMG points: 1P and 4B. PP2BP4_ModerateBP6BS2_Supporting
The NM_001042492.3(NF1):c.2257G>A(p.Ala753Thr)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000103 in 1,461,376 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 13/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ars).

not specified Uncertain:1
Variant summary: NF1 c.2257G>A (p.Ala753Thr) results in a non-conservative amino acid change in the encoded protein sequence. Three of five in-silico tools predict a benign effect of the variant on protein function. The variant allele was found at a frequency of 8e-06 in 250628 control chromosomes. The available data on variant occurrences in the general population are insufficient to allow any conclusion about variant significance. To our knowledge, no occurrence of c.2257G>A in individuals affected with Neurofibromatosis Type 1 and no experimental evidence demonstrating its impact on protein function have been reported. ClinVar contains an entry for this variant (Variation ID: 237533). Based on the evidence outlined above, the variant was classified as uncertain significance. -
